What Is Morphallaxis

What Is Morphallaxis - Epimorphosis and morphallaxis are two types of tissue or organ regeneration processes observed in animals, primarily in invertebrates. Morphallaxis is a regenerative process characterized by the remodeling and reorganization of existing tissues to replace. Morphallaxis is the when some living things regenerate or regrow tissue after the original tissue dies. The word comes from the greek.
